Output f65a3755304fc5b973d1fdcafac8544a7be2157f9ec32f25122e88944384499e:0

value
653868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40f677342d3718d6a9e31c354e821373b6802908 OP_EQUAL
address
37cWRZ5AMJfsmKLvQzes3zPUhrnf9mnLRt
transaction
f65a3755304fc5b973d1fdcafac8544a7be2157f9ec32f25122e88944384499e
spent
true